Resumo

It is evident that public sector is one of significant factors affecting an economic and social situation in particular countries (regions), and therefore the measuring of public sector efficiency has received a more attention in recent years. The current situation of the world economy requires a proper and efficient use of public resources. The measuring of public sector efficiency is difficult and an understanding current level of public sector efficiency is a prerequisite to understanding what saving might be possible in the future. There are several approaches that can be used to identify both efficient and inefficient activities in the public sector. The article is focused on investigating the public sector efficiency within selected European regions on the base of data from international databases (World Bank, Eurostat, WEO database) in the years of 1994-2009. From the methodological point of view, there are used several approaches for measuring a public sector efficiency of European regions including simple methods (public sector performance (PSP) and public sector efficiency (PSE)) and mathematical method such as Data Envelopment Analysis (DEA). The article outlines the existence of significant differences in the level of public sector efficiency within the selected European regions in time period.
